The Nokia Lumia 2520 is just a bit better than Huawei MediaPad 10 Link, having a overall score of 68.6 against 63.7. Nokia Lumia 2520 counts with Windows RT 8.1 OS, while Huawei MediaPad 10 Link counts with Android 4.1 OS. The Nokia Lumia 2520 is a thinner and a little bit lighter tablet than the Huawei MediaPad 10 Link.
The Nokia Lumia 2520 counts with a much better looking display than Huawei MediaPad 10 Link, and although they both have a display with the same size, the Nokia Lumia 2520 also has more pixels per inch in the display and a much better 1080 x 1920 resolution. Lumia 2520 counts with a quite better processing power than Huawei MediaPad 10 Link, and although they both have a Quad-Core processing unit, the Lumia 2520 also has more RAM memory and an extra graphics processing unit.
Nokia Lumia 2520 shoots much clearer photographs and videos than Huawei MediaPad 10 Link, and although they both have the same video quality and the same 30 fps video frame rates, the Nokia Lumia 2520 also has a camera with lot more MP. The Huawei MediaPad 10 Link's memory capacity for games and applications is very similar to Lumia 2520's one, they have equal internal memory capacity and a slot for an external memory card that allows up to 32 GB.
Lumia 2520 has better battery life than Huawei MediaPad 10 Link, because it has a 21 percent larger battery size.
Lumia 2520 costs a bit more than the Huawei MediaPad 10 Link, but you can get a better tablet for that extra money.
